Speed Signal Circuit [11/2021 - 03/2024]: Procedure
- INSPECT COMBINATION METER ASSEMBLY (INPUT WAVEFORM)
*a Component with harness connected
(Combination Meter Assembly)*b Input Waveform - Check the signal waveform according to the condition(s) in the table below.
Item Condition Tester connection D21-25 (SI) - Body ground Tool setting 5 V/DIV., 20 ms./DIV. Condition Ignition switch ON, wheel being rotated NOTE:Perform the inspection from the back of the connector with the connector connected.
HINT:
When the system is functioning normally, one wheel revolution generates 4 pulses. As the vehicle speed increases, the width indicated by (A) in the illustration narrows.

- INSPECT COMBINATION METER ASSEMBLY (OUTPUT WAVEFORM)
*a Component with harness connected
(Combination Meter Assembly)*b Output Waveform - Check the signal waveform according to the condition(s) in the table below.
Item Condition Tester connection D21-8 (+S) - Body ground Tool setting 5 V/DIV., 20 ms./DIV. Condition Ignition switch ON, wheel being rotated NOTE:Perform the inspection from the back of the connector with the connector connected.
HINT:
- When the system is functioning normally, one wheel revolution generates 4 pulses. As the vehicle speed increases, the width indicated by (A) in the illustration narrows.
- The waveform (B) changes depending on the connected ECUs.

- INSPECT EACH ECU (INTERNAL SHORT)
- Disconnect one of the connectors below.NOTE:
After disconnecting a connector, perform all steps with all other devices connected.
Connector ECU A20*1 ECM A19*2 D1 Radio and display receiver assembly D35*3 Stereo component amplifier assembly D37*4 - *1: for Gasoline Model (for A25A-FKS)
- *2: for Gasoline Model (for T24A-FTS)
- *3: for 17 Speakers
- *4: for 10 Speakers
- Measure the voltage according to the value(s) in the table below.
*a Component with harness connected
(Combination Meter Assembly)NOTE:- Make sure to perform this inspection with the wheels stopped.
- Perform the inspection from the back of the connector with the connector connected.
Standard Voltage
Tester Connection Condition Specified Condition D21-8 (+S) - Body ground Ignition switch ON 4.5 to 14 V - Repeat steps (a) and (b) for each connected ECU.
HINT:
If the waveform changes to the waveform shown in the illustration after disconnecting a connector, an internal short in the disconnected ECU is suspected.
